Defining Continuing Education and Its Purposes

Continuing education represents a structured approach for professionals to maintain, enhance, and expand their knowledge and skills throughout their career journey. Unlike traditional academic learning confined to specific timeframes, continuing professional development (CPD) provides an ongoing learning pathway that adapts to evolving industry demands and technological advancements.

At its core, continuing education serves multiple critical purposes for professionals across various sectors:

  • Maintaining professional competency and relevance in rapidly changing industries
  • Ensuring compliance with licensing and regulatory requirements
  • Expanding technical skills and knowledge base
  • Supporting career advancement and personal growth
  • Facilitating organizational innovation and workforce adaptability

The landscape of continuing professional development encompasses both formal and informal learning activities designed to help professionals continuously upgrade their capabilities. These activities might include structured training programs, workshops, online courses, conferences, self-directed learning, and industry certifications.

For manufacturers specifically, continuing education plays a pivotal role in addressing skill gaps, maintaining technological currency, and ensuring workforce readiness. By investing in ongoing learning initiatives, companies can transform their workforce from static resources into dynamic, adaptable teams capable of driving organizational innovation.

Major Types and Industry-Specific Differences

Continuing education encompasses a diverse range of learning formats designed to meet the unique needs of different professional sectors. Types of continuing education vary widely, reflecting the specialized requirements of industries and individual career development goals.

The primary categories of continuing education include:

  • Post-Secondary Degree Programs: Advanced academic courses for professional advancement
  • Professional Certifications: Industry-specific credentials validating specialized skills
  • Independent Studies: Self-directed learning modules and research opportunities
  • Professional Events: Conferences, seminars, and workshops
  • On-the-Job Training: Practical skill development within workplace settings

Manufacturing and technical fields demonstrate particularly unique continuing education characteristics. These industries often prioritize hands-on training and technical certifications that directly align with technological advancements and operational requirements. Unlike corporate sectors that might emphasize theoretical workshops, manufacturers focus on practical skill acquisition and technical competency.

Here’s a comparison of continuing education formats across professional sectors:

Format Type Manufacturing Focus Corporate Sector Focus Accessibility
Technical Certification Emphasized for up-to-date skills Optional or supplemental Moderate
Workshops & Seminars Hands-on, operational Theory-driven, strategic High
Online Courses Targeted, skill-specific Broad personal development Very High
On-the-Job Training Core workforce strategy Supplemental learning High

The evolving landscape of continuing education has been significantly transformed by digital learning platforms. Online learning options such as Massive Open Online Courses (MOOCs) and industry-specific digital training programs have made professional development more accessible and flexible, allowing professionals to upgrade their skills without disrupting their work schedules.

How Continuing Education Works in Practice

Continuing Professional Development (CPD) functions as a dynamic, iterative process that enables professionals to systematically enhance their skills and knowledge. Continuous learning strategies involve a structured approach of identifying learning needs, engaging in targeted development activities, and reflecting on professional growth.

The practical implementation of continuing education typically follows a strategic framework:

  • Needs Assessment: Identifying skill gaps and learning objectives
  • Learning Planning: Developing a personalized development roadmap
  • Active Learning: Participating in formal and informal educational experiences
  • Implementation: Applying new knowledge in professional contexts
  • Reflection and Evaluation: Analyzing learning outcomes and impact

For manufacturers, continuing education works through a comprehensive approach that integrates workplace learning, formal instruction, and technological adaptation. This approach ensures that professionals remain current with emerging technologies, industry standards, and operational best practices. By creating a systematic learning environment, organizations can transform continuing education from a compliance requirement into a strategic competitive advantage.

Common Requirements and Accreditation Standards

Continuing education programs must adhere to rigorous accreditation standards that ensure educational quality, professional integrity, and meaningful learning outcomes. These standards establish comprehensive guidelines that protect the interests of learners, institutions, and industries by maintaining consistent educational benchmarks.

Key elements of continuing education accreditation typically include:

  • Content Validity: Ensuring educational materials are current, accurate, and professionally relevant
  • Instructional Design: Developing structured learning experiences with clear objectives
  • Assessment Mechanisms: Creating robust methods to evaluate learning comprehension
  • Instructor Qualifications: Verifying subject matter expertise and teaching competence
  • Ethical Standards: Maintaining independence from commercial bias and conflicts of interest

For manufacturers, accreditation requirements often focus on technical precision, industry-specific knowledge, and practical skill development. These standards go beyond traditional academic metrics, emphasizing real-world application and technological competency. Professional bodies carefully evaluate continuing education programs to ensure they deliver tangible value to participants and their respective industries.

Risks, Pitfalls, and Strategic Value for Manufacturers

Manufacturers face significant challenges in implementing continuing education programs, with strategic risks and opportunities deeply impacting organizational competitiveness. Understanding these dynamics is crucial for developing effective workforce development strategies.

Key risks and potential pitfalls in continuing education include:

  • Technological Obsolescence: Failure to keep pace with rapidly evolving manufacturing technologies
  • Resource Misallocation: Investing in training programs with limited practical relevance
  • Skills Mismatch: Creating educational content that does not align with actual workforce needs
  • Compliance Challenges: Navigating complex regulatory requirements
  • Return on Investment Uncertainty: Difficulty measuring direct educational impact

The strategic value of continuing education extends far beyond simple skill enhancement. Manufacturers who effectively implement comprehensive learning programs can transform workforce development from a compliance requirement into a competitive advantage. By creating adaptive learning ecosystems, organizations can foster innovation, improve operational efficiency, and build a more resilient workforce capable of navigating complex technological transitions.

Successful continuing education strategies require a holistic approach that integrates organizational culture, targeted learning interventions, and measurable performance outcomes. This means moving beyond traditional training models to create dynamic, responsive educational frameworks that continuously evolve with industry demands.
